The integration of RFID technology into label materials is revolutionizing supply chain processes. RFID-enabled labels streamline tracking and inventory management. This enhances visibility, reduces errors, and ultimately saves time. Supply chains become more efficient as real-time data replaces outdated manual systems. Companies efficiently monitor each item, addressing discrepancies quickly.
To implement RFID effectively, it is crucial to choose the right label material. Consider the environment where the labels will be used. Harsh conditions can damage standard labels. Specifying durable materials can ensure better performance.

Smart labels are transforming how consumers interact with products. These labels integrate IoT technology to provide real-time data about items. Imagine scanning a food package to reveal its origin, expiration, and nutritional values. This instant access to information increases consumer trust and encourages more informed choices.
However, challenges remain in the smart label space. Many consumers may not fully understand how to use these features effectively. The technology may also raise concerns about data privacy and security. Not every consumer has the same level of tech familiarity. Companies must address these barriers to ensure broad accessibility.
